A house was destroyed and one man was hospitalized when a large fire broke out in the attic area.
Fire Chief John Dougherty says the Wilton Fire Department got a call for a house fire about 9 a.m. Friday. The Norwalk Fire Department along with Wilton Fire and EMS responded to the fire.
Four people including two babies where in the house when the fire broke out. Dougherty says the fire started in the attic and spread to the rest of the house. He says with weather conditions the fire department couldn't access its water supply right away because it was frozen.
"It could be worse we could have lost some lives on this. It’s just a house. The house I’d say is probably a total loss at this time," Dougherty says.
One person was taken to a Sparta hospital for smoke inhalation. The cause of the fire is still under investigation.
